Lon­don firms have raised more than £130,000 for nation­al char­i­ty UK Youth at a high pro­file event in asso­ci­a­tion with UPS and sup­port­ed by their pres­i­dent Nigel Mansell CBE

Banks, legal firms, asset man­agers and con­sul­tan­cies ral­lied to sup­port the charity’s sixth Annu­al Gala Din­ner at Bois­dale of Canary Wharf for 200 guests.

Through­out the evening guests heard about the chal­lenges fac­ing our young peo­ple today and the role they can play in sup­port­ing them to build bright futures what­ev­er their back­ground or cir­cum­stances. The atmos­phere at Bois­dale was fan­tas­tic with young per­form­ers from UK Youth’s Big Music Project show­cas­ing their work.

The main event of the evening was the auc­tion which raised an impres­sive £28,000 with prizes rang­ing from tick­ets to the British Grand Prix, a box at the Roy­al Opera House, Bespoke Spec­ta­cles by Tom Davies and tick­ets in the Direc­tors Box at Chelsea.

Found­ed in 1911, UK Youth is the largest nation­al body for the youth sec­tor, pro­vid­ing young peo­ple aged 9 – 25 with high qual­i­ty ser­vices, deliv­ered through a net­work of local­ly acces­si­ble youth organ­i­sa­tions across the UK. Through this unique mod­el, UK Youth offers sup­port, advice and train­ing to over 830,000 young peo­ple to equip them with vital life skills and help them engage in edu­ca­tion, vol­un­teer­ing and employment.

The mon­ey raised at the Gala Din­ner will help UK Youth work towards real­is­ing their mis­sion of pro­vid­ing access to appro­pri­ate, high qual­i­ty ser­vices for young peo­ple in every com­mu­ni­ty so that all young peo­ple are empow­ered to build bright futures, regard­less of their back­ground or circumstances.
